India, April 30 -- Chennai Super Kings, once the strongest force in the history of the Indian Premier League, are pretty much out of IPL 2025. Auction blunders, injury to their captain, the waning force that is MS Dhoni, along with a truckload of other factors, have led to their dismal show this year. Mathematically, they may still be in contention to qualify for the Playoffs - all teams always are - but CSK's chances this season are pretty much shut. Dhoni has already hinted that the team should focus on next season, when he hopes to 'get a secured XI next year and come back strong'.
